Core Calculation Logic

The Calculus Calculator works using standard calculus rules:

1. Differentiation Rules

  • Power Rule: d/dx(xⁿ) = n·xⁿ⁻¹
  • Product Rule: (uv)’ = u’v + uv’
  • Quotient Rule: (u/v)’ = (u’v – uv’) / v²
  • Chain Rule: d/dx[f(g(x))] = f'(g(x)) · g'(x)

2. Integration Rules

  • ∫xⁿ dx = xⁿ⁺¹ / (n+1) + C
  • ∫sin(x) dx = -cos(x) + C
  • ∫eˣ dx = eˣ + C

3. Limit Rules

  • Direct substitution
  • L’Hôpital’s Rule (for indeterminate forms)
  • Factorization and simplification

Practical Examples

Example 1: Derivative

Function: f(x) = x² + 3x
Result: f'(x) = 2x + 3

Example 2: Definite Integral

Function: ∫(2x) dx from 0 to 3
Result: 9

Example 3: Limit

lim (x→2) (x² – 4)/(x – 2)
Result: 4
